One Billion SMARTRAC RFID Inlays and PRELAM(R) Products Employing Wire-embedding Technology Supplied

(DGAP-Media / 17.10.2012 / 09:00) 
 
One Billion SMARTRAC RFID Inlays and PRELAM(R) Products Employing 
Wire-embedding Technology Supplied 
 
Amsterdam, October 17, 2012 - SMARTRAC N.V., the leading developer, 
manufacturer, and supplier of RFID transponders and inlays, announced that 
it has produced and supplied more than one billion RFID inlays and 
PRELAM(R) products manufactured with its patented wire-embedding 
technology. 
 
SMARTRAC's proprietary and patented wire-embedding technology has proven 
itself to be the manufacturing technology of choice for contactless 
antennas with the highest product performance for high-profile 
applications. Card manufacturers and players in the high-security printing 
industry consider wire-embedding technology the de-facto standard for 
products which have to fulfil the highest quality, reliability, and 
durability requirements. 
 
RFID inlays and PRELAM(R) products employing wire-embedding technology are 
used for the production of high-security documents such as e-passports, 
RFID-based national ID Cards, electronic permanent resident cards, etc. 
SMARTRAC's wire-embedding products have also proven their superiority in 
the contactless payment industry, in automated fare collection, loyalty 
programs, and multi-application cards.

About SMARTRAC: 
SMARTRAC is the leading developer, manufacturer, and supplier of RFID and 
NFC transponders and inlays. The company produces both ready-made and 
customized transponders and inlays used in access control, animal 
identification, automated fare collection, border control, RFID-based car 
immobilizers, contactless payment cards, electronic product identification, 
industry, libraries and media management, laundry, logistics, mobile and 
smart media, public transport, retail, and many more. 
 
SMARTRAC was founded in 2000, went public in July 2006, and trades as a 
stock corporation under Dutch law with its registered headquarters in 
Amsterdam. The company currently employs some 4,000 employees and maintains 
a global research and development, production, and sales network.
